Telecommunication system to stream sports events & tournaments
SkyLog is the advanced telecommunication system created to distribute exclusive video content.

Client
BroadTeam
Location
France
Duration
Oct, 2016 - Now
Overview
Originally, SkyLog was intended to stream sport events and tournaments. But customer expanded verticals to cover festivals, concerts, and other large events with the engagement of media agencies, journalists and bloggers. This video streaming platform records events and separate videos on pieces for further usage by journalists, etc.
Challenge
The challenge was that the software needed to work with a Windows application as well as a web application. We created the software, as well as a database in MySQL and an API, so the system can access all the data. Customer had an architecture in mind, and we were able to suggest a new architecture and how we’d like to do things to better help them.
Solutions
We released: real-time streaming on Wowza engine; processing of various video formats; applied indexation of key moments by time code; added generation and export of log sheets for key moments with standard and custom tags (keywords, sports teams, artists, celebrities, etc.); applied real-time synchronization with Desktop and Web components within a single account; created and acquired log sheets and video files.


Web Platform
Desktop application
Real time streaming on Wowza engine; Processing of various video formats; Indexation of key moments by time code; Generation and export of log sheets for key moments with standard and custom tags (keywords, sports teams, artists, celebrities, etc.); Log sheet templates.
Mobile Platform
eCommerce platform
Management of personal/corporate subscription; Distribution of exclusive footage and timelogs; Customizable catalogs and categories; Partnership portal; Payment gateways; Financial records and Analytics.


Tablet Platform
Mobile application
Real time synchronization with Desktop and Web components within single account; Access to created and acquired log sheets and video files; Filter of available materials.
Results
Before
Customer requested to extend the existed team of developers under his own project management. Teams were requested to solve the next tech issues: processing of different video formats; caching of streamed videos; processing of large data arrays; correct storyboard generation for footage.
After
We developed custom player on C# from scratch. Implemented manual configuration of the player to comply system requirements; applied advanced calculations. Per now company engaged 6 media partners and got over 100 individual contributors.

Let’s talk.
Sent!